Combining PET/CT with serum tumor markers to improve the evaluation of histological type of suspicious lung cancers.
PloS one - 1 Jan 2017
Jiang Rifeng, Dong Ximin, Zhu Wenzhen, Duan Qing, Xue Yunjing, Shen Yanxia, Zhang Guopeng
Abstract excerpt
OBJECTIVE: Histological type is important for determining the management of patients with suspicious lung cancers. In this study, PET/CT combined with serum tumor markers were used to evaluate the histological type of lung lesions. MATERIALS AND METHODS: Patients with suspicious lung cancers underwent 18F-FDG PET/CT and serum tumor markers detection. SUVmax of the tumor and serum levels of tumor markers were...
